Happy Thanksgiving

Here is a little idea for place cards at your Thanksgiving table.

I used mini pie pumpkins and wrote each guests name on card stock, and
added a sticker. Then I put a slit in the stem and inserted the card.

Your can decorate the card with stickers, or what ever you like.

Each guest can take the pumpkin home and bake a pumpkin pie.
